Senior Goalkeeper Rachel Duckworth has committed to play basketball for the Cottey College Comets in Nevada, MO. Cottey College is a two-year, independent, liberal arts and sciences college for women.
Rachel’s signing ceremony will be in the Glendale Library on April 10 at 3:00pm.

The Falcons defeated the Joplin Eagles, 4-0.
Match Stats: Lindsey Sprouse (2G/1A), Jeni Frewin (1G/1A), Emily Cline (1G), Emily Jordan (1A).
